发动机转速和频率的关系
时间: 2024-04-21 17:29:40 浏览: 17
发动机的转速和频率之间存在着一定的关系。通常情况下,发动机的转速是指发动机每分钟旋转的圈数,单位是转/分钟(rpm);而频率是指交流电的周期数,单位是赫兹(Hz)。在发电机中,发动机的转速和输出电压的频率有着直接的联系。具体地说,当发动机的转速增加时,输出电压的频率也会相应地增加;反之,当发动机的转速降低时,输出电压的频率也会相应地降低。一般来说,标准的电网频率是50Hz或60Hz,因此发电机需要保持相应的转速来保证输出电压的频率稳定。
相关问题
基于单片机的发动机转速采集处理
发动机转速采集处理是汽车电子控制系统中非常重要的一环,主要涉及到车辆故障诊断和燃油经济性等问题。基于单片机的发动机转速采集处理系统设计可以实现对发动机转速信号的采集、处理和输出,具有成本低、功耗小、易于维护等优点。
下面是基于单片机的发动机转速采集处理系统的设计方案:
1. 采集模块:通过安装在发动机上的传感器,采集发动机旋转的位置和速度,并将信号传输给单片机处理器。
2. 处理模块:采用定时器/计数器模块对采集到的信号进行计数和处理。通过设置计数器的计数频率,可以精确地计算发动机的转速。
3. 显示模块:将处理后的数据通过LCD显示器进行显示,包括发动机转速和故障码等信息。同时,还可以通过串口通信将数据发送到上位机进行进一步处理和分析。
4. 软件设计:编写单片机程序实现数据采集、处理和显示等功能。同时,还需要考虑系统的稳定性和可靠性,例如采用中断处理机制,避免计数器溢出等问题。
总之,基于单片机的发动机转速采集处理系统设计是一个比较复杂的工程,需要充分考虑系统的稳定性、可靠性和实用性等因素。通过合理的设计和优化,可以实现高精度、低功耗、易于维护的发动机转速采集处理系统。
用数码管发动机转速检测的keil程序
数码管发动机转速检测的Keil程序主要是通过将数码管与单片机进行连接,利用单片机的定时器来检测发动机的转速,并将检测结果显示在数码管上。
程序首先需要初始化单片机的GPIO口和定时器,以及数码管的引脚。然后编写中断服务程序,用于处理定时器计数达到指定值时的任务。在中断服务程序中,需要编写代码来读取发动机传感器发出的信号,根据脉冲信号的频率计算出发动机的转速,并将转速值转换为数码管可以显示的格式。
在主程序中,需要设置定时器的工作模式和计数范围,然后启动定时器。同时,使用一个无限循环来保持程序持续运行,定时器中断服务程序会在每个计数周期内被触发,进行发动机转速的检测和数码管的显示。
此外,还需要进行错误处理和数据校验,确保程序的稳定性和准确性。在数码管上显示发动机的转速时,需要注意处理数码管显示的更新和刷新,以确保转速数据能够正确地在数码管上显示。
最后,完成程序的编写之后,还需要进行实际的调试和测试,确保程序能够准确地检测发动机的转速并正确地显示在数码管上。同时也需要考虑可能出现的干扰和误差,对程序进行优化和改进。通过这样的Keil程序,可以方便地实现对发动机转速的实时监测和显示。